音乐播放器实例


音乐播放器实例是一个综合性的项目,它涉及到多个技术领域,主要使用了Java、HTML、JavaScript以及jQuery库来构建。这个项目旨在提供一个用户友好的界面,让用户能够方便地播放、控制音乐,同时还支持歌词显示等功能。下面将详细介绍这些技术在音乐播放器中的应用及其重要性。 1. **Java**: 在这个项目中,Java可能被用于后端开发,处理服务器端的数据交互。例如,Java可以用来管理音乐文件的存储和检索,实现播放列表的动态更新,以及处理用户登录和权限验证等逻辑。此外,Java还可以与数据库进行交互,存储用户的偏好设置或播放历史。 2. **HTML**: HTML(超文本标记语言)是构建网页内容的基础。在音乐播放器的界面设计中,HTML用于定义各种元素,如播放按钮、进度条、歌曲列表、歌词区域等。通过合理的布局和结构化标签,可以让用户界面更加直观易用。 3. **JavaScript**: JavaScript是网页动态功能的核心,它负责处理用户交互、页面更新和动画效果。在音乐播放器中,JavaScript用于控制音乐的播放、暂停、前进和后退,以及调整音量等功能。同时,JavaScript还可以实时更新播放进度条,并实现歌词同步滚动。 4. **jQuery**: jQuery是一个JavaScript库,它简化了JavaScript的DOM操作和事件处理。在音乐播放器项目中,jQuery可以更方便地绑定事件监听器,比如点击按钮触发播放或暂停操作。同时,它还可以帮助实现复杂的动画效果,如淡入淡出、滑动切换等,提高用户体验。 5. **音乐播放功能**: 实现上一首、下一首的切换,需要JavaScript或jQuery监听相关按钮的点击事件,然后根据当前播放的歌曲索引进行加减操作,从而加载并播放新的音乐文件。同时,还需要处理播放列表,确保歌曲的顺序正确。 6. **列表播放**: 列表播放功能涉及到JavaScript数组的处理,音乐文件名可以存储在数组中,通过遍历数组实现歌曲的循环播放。用户选择歌曲时,可以通过索引来查找对应的音乐文件。 7. **歌词功能**: 歌词通常是以时间戳格式存储的,JavaScript需要解析歌词文件,将歌词与音乐播放进度关联起来。当播放器的时间位置匹配到某个时间戳时,对应的歌词会显示在界面上。 8. **用户交互设计**: 良好的用户交互设计是音乐播放器成功的关键。这包括清晰的界面布局、直观的控件操作,以及响应式的用户体验。HTML和CSS(层叠样式表)可以协同工作,为播放器提供美观且功能齐全的界面。 这个“音乐播放器实例”项目涵盖了前后端开发、用户交互设计等多个重要环节,是学习和实践Web开发技能的好案例。通过深入理解和实现这样的项目,开发者可以提升自己在Java、HTML、JavaScript和jQuery方面的综合能力。

































































































- 1


- 粉丝: 35
我的内容管理 展开
我的资源 快来上传第一个资源
我的收益
登录查看自己的收益我的积分 登录查看自己的积分
我的C币 登录后查看C币余额
我的收藏
我的下载
下载帮助


最新资源
- 电子商务公司薪资体系.doc
- 电子商务案例分析课程标准.doc
- 完美版课件资料第6章 MCS-51单片机的中断系统.ppt
- 2023年公需科目考试物联网技术与应用考试题库含全部答案.doc
- 软件产品需求说明规范.pdf
- 工程项目管理信息系统功能培训手册样本.doc
- 互联网大赛项目淘书汇申请书.docx
- 基于云技术的医疗卫生信息网络服务体系应用工作汇报).ppt
- -互联网+-会计行业创新发展的新动能【会计实务操作教程】.pptx
- 单片机红外发射与接收.doc
- 职业院校信息化教学大赛赛项方案汇总.doc
- 视频转GIF怎么转?用什么软件比较好?.pdf
- 流水和网络图讲解[最终版].pdf
- 2023年使用互联网的固定IP用户安全责任书.doc
- 基于改进A星算法的仿生机器鱼全局路径规划样本.doc
- 学习新预算法心得体会概要.doc


